Information Lydia P. would like to know about your pet
I like to know about your cat or dog's special needs: are they seniors, do they require any medication or special foods, are they barkers, how often do they poo, what is their regular exercise routine, have you had your dog since a puppy, what type of training did you do, are there any social issues I need to know about, and how do they interact with children or other dogs on walks?
A typical day
I love having a dog by my side and when I do errands I also like to take them with me if they like the adventure and a car ride. I am a big believer that humans and animals need to be outside enjoying the fresh air. I have had dogs my whole life and have always walked them at least 2x per day for at least 30-45 minutes. When time permits, and especially on the weekends, we are in the car looking for a trail, dog park, beach or a stroll someplace new. Depending on where you are located I could be a Cavallo Point, or Rodeo Beach, Sausalito Boardwalk, Civic Center pond, McGinnis fields, and trails, along the Target water walkway, and even Pt. Isabel in Richmond or the Marina Green on the weekends. I am a big walker myself and walk a couple of miles a day as my normal practice. I always have balls, a chucker, and a water bowl in the car because it's all about playtime!
